RF defence min to hold meeting on formation of state defence order
.
NIZHNY NOVGOROV, December 24 (Itar-Tass) - Russian Defence Minister
Anatoly Serdyukov will hold a meeting in Nizhny Novgorod on Thursday with
the leadership of defence complex enterprises of the region. The press
service of the regional government told Itar-Tass that the meeting will
discuss issues of the formation and fulfilment of the state defence order.
A total of 55 enterprises in the Nizhny Novgorod region work under the
state defence order and 40 percent of them have direct contracts with the
Defence Ministry. Within the framework of the one-day visit the minister
will visit one of such enterprises - the Federal Research and Production
Centre "Nizhny Novgorod Research Institute of Radio Engineering" (NNIIRT).
This institute is the head contractor of practically all works under the
state defence order.
NNIIRT for 60 years has been engaged in the designing and production
of radiolocation stations and complexes that today make the basis of the
country's air defence. The main consumers of the products are the Defence
Ministry and Rosoboronexpotr arms exporting company. More than 25 types of
radiolocation systems designed by the institute are adopted for service in
the anti-ballistic missile defence and are also used in 52 countries.
Governor of the Nizhny Novgorod region Valery Shantsev will accompany
the defence minister on his trip.

.Alexander Zhilkin to take office of Astrakhan region governor.
VOLGOGRAD, December 24 (Itar-Tass) - Alexander Zhilkin is taking
office of the Astrakhan region's governor. The press service of the
administration of the Astrakhan region told Itar-Tass that his
inauguration ceremony will be held in Astrakhan on Thursday.
Zhilkin, 50, born in the Astrakhan region, will become the second
Russian governor who took this post in accordance with the new order of
vesting powers in heads of RF subjects offered by the Russian president in
2008. Head of the Sverdlovsk region administration Alexander Misharin
became the first such governor on November 23.
Russian President Dmitry Medvedev proposed the candidature of Zhilkin
for the post of governor. On December 9, deputies of the Astrakhan
regional Duma (legislature) unanimously voted for his candidacy.
Alexander Zhilkin has a degree of Ph.D. in Economics he has for a long
time worked in the education sphere. In 1991 - 2004 he was first deputy
head of the Astrakhan region administration and since 2004 - regional
governor.

.Azeri FM to discuss bilateral relations, region security in Ankara.
BAKU, December 24 (Itar-Tass) - Issues of bilateral relations and
regional security will be in the focus of discussion in Ankara on
Thursday, as Azerbaijani Foreign Minister Elmar Mamedyarov is embarking on
a visit to Turkey.
According to diplomatic sources in Baku, Mamedyarov plans talks with
his Turkish colleague Ahmet Davutoglu, meetings with President Abdullah
Gul, Prime Minister Tayyip Recep Erdogan and parliament head Mehmet Ali
Shahin. Among the main issues for discussion are expected to be the
Nagorno-Karabakh conflict settlement and normalisation of Turkish-Armenian
relations. Official Baku prefers to consider these to processes in
conjunction. It is certain that the opening of borders between Turkey and
Armenia before the settlement of the Nagorno-Karabakh conflict may prolong
its solution.
Azerbaijan has rather negatively taken the rapprochement process
between Turkey and Armenia indicating that in this case it may correct its
regional policy. It became calm only after the Turkish top leadership
assured Azerbaijan that it would not open borders with Armenia before the
settlement of the Nagorno-Karabakh conflict and will still take problems
of Azerbaijan as its own. On the whole Baku would want Ankara's more
active participation in the peacekeeping process regarding Turkey as a
guarantor of its interests.
It is also not ruled out that during the talks of the Azerbaijani
foreign minister the sides will also touch upon issues of economic
cooperation between the two countries and their participation in regional
projects.

.Sergei Ivanov to sum up migration experiment results.
MOSCOW, December 24 (Itar-Tass) - The meeting to summarise the results
of an experiment of registration and issuing of migration cards right in
the passport control booth will be held at the international airport
Vnukovo on Thursday. Russian Vice Prime Minister Sergei Ivanov and Moscow
mayor Yuri Luzhkov will assess the efficiency of the new system.
The experiment is aimed at the simplification of the transfer of data
on entry and exit of foreigners through the Russian border. If earlier the
arriving foreigners had to fill in on their own a migration card and then
these data were put in the system, then now the migration card is filled
in by the operator and the information automatically gets into the
migration registration system.
At the moment the news system is working only at Moscow's Vnukovo
airport. There are 43 passport control booths installed there for the
purpose with server equipment and the needed software and contracted
communications channels. With the use of such equipment the information
retrieval takes 3 minutes for a file on the average that contains data on
300-700 foreigners.
In the future the RF migration authorities plan to introduce such
system at all border checkpoints.
